Announcing our first global engagement survey results with Great Place To Work
Three company's affiliates - Brazil, China and India - have already been certified as Great Place To Work in this first round

Italmatch Chemicals is proud to announce the results of its first global engagement survey, conducted in partnership with Great Place To Work, a global leader in workplace culture and employee experience.
As we take this opportunity to thank again our employees for taking part in the survey, we are delighted to announce that three of our affiliates – Brazil, China and India – have already been certified as Great Place To Work in this first round.
